ASHBURTON'S town clerk John Germon is usually to be found in these pages chivvying council officials over holes in the road, overgrown vegetation and the myriad other queries which cross his desk.
Now he has chosen to share his gentler side with an inquiry about primroses.
Intrigued by reports that Ashburton had some unusual primroses with six, rather than the usual five petals, John set out with his camera.
'I decided to see if I could find them and after a long look around I found one.
